Lachie Kennedy joins Jemima Montag in pulling out of world titles in dual blow for Australia

Australian Athletics Squad Suffers Dual Setback Ahead of World Championships Two prominent Australian athletes, sprinter Lachie Kennedy and race walker Jemima Montag, have withdrawn from the upcoming World Athletics Championships in Tokyo due to injuries. Kennedy, one of the country's fastest 100m runners, has been forced to skip the event. Montag, a medal hopeful in the race walk, will undergo surgery on a hamstring injury. The withdrawals are a significant blow to Australia's athletics squad, which was anticipating strong performances from both athletes at the global event. Kennedy's absence removes one of the nation's brightest emerging sprinting talents, while Montag's injury jeopardizes her chances of medaling in the race walk. The World Athletics Championships are scheduled to commence on September 13th in Tokyo, and the loss of these two athletes is a setback for the Australian team as they prepare to compete against the world's best.
